Smash that reply button and share your honest opinion with us. 👀 Don't call it a comeback!In our digital world, out-of-home advertising doesn't feel as ~sexy~ as it used to. But, believe it or not (and yes, we were *shook* reading this too!), OOH rose by 40.5% in the first quarter compared to Q1 2021... whoa whoa whoa, what?! OOH placements, like a fine wine, have matured with age and in 2022, they've got a lot more to offer than simply maximizing eyeballs on ye old static billboard. They're now able to drive all sorts of consumer behaviors and serve as a connection point between IRL and online, extending consumer engagement past a singular touchpoint. OOH is giving "I'm a laid back, cool guy" vibe being there when the consumer is ready as opposed to those pesky (read: desparate) digital ads that non-stop stalk you from website to website with ZERO chill. This is probably why they've got a pretty stellar favorability rating among consumers. SMALL BITES Maybe just, don't start a TikTok? Net zero ads!!
